黑狐家游戏

集中式和分布式信息处理的优缺点有哪些,集中式和分布式信息处理的优缺点

欧气 2 0

《集中式与分布式信息处理:剖析优缺点》

一、集中式信息处理的优缺点

集中式和分布式信息处理的优缺点有哪些,集中式和分布式信息处理的优缺点

图片来源于网络,如有侵权联系删除

(一)优点

1、管理与控制的高效性

- 在集中式信息处理系统中,所有的数据和处理任务都集中在一个中心位置,例如一个大型的数据中心,这使得管理和控制变得相对简单,系统管理员可以在一个地方对整个系统进行监控、配置和维护,对于企业来说,如果有统一的业务流程和规范,集中式系统能够确保所有的操作都遵循这些标准,一家连锁超市采用集中式的库存管理系统,总部可以实时监控各个门店的库存情况,统一调配货物,避免库存积压或缺货现象,从而提高整体运营效率。

- 集中式系统在安全管理方面也具有优势,由于数据集中存储,可以更方便地实施统一的安全策略,如防火墙设置、访问控制和数据加密等,安全团队可以集中精力保护一个核心的数据存储和处理中心,防止外部威胁入侵,确保数据的保密性、完整性和可用性。

2、资源利用率高

- 集中式信息处理能够对硬件、软件和人力资源进行集中调配,大型的数据中心可以采用高端的服务器和存储设备,通过虚拟化技术等手段,将这些资源分配给不同的应用和用户,这种集中式的资源管理可以避免资源的闲置和浪费,一个企业的多个部门可能在不同时段对计算资源有不同的需求,在集中式系统中,可以根据各部门的实际需求动态分配服务器的计算能力,提高整个企业计算资源的利用率。

- 软件的许可证管理也更加便捷,企业只需要购买一套软件许可证供集中式系统使用,而不需要为每个部门或用户单独购买,从而降低了软件采购成本。

3、数据一致性容易保证

- 所有的数据都存储在一个中心数据库中,这使得数据的一致性维护相对容易,当有数据更新操作时,只需要在中心数据库进行一次更新操作,就可以确保所有使用该数据的应用和用户获取到最新的数据,在银行的集中式核心业务系统中,当客户的账户余额发生变化时,系统在中心数据库更新该余额信息,所有与该账户相关的查询、转账等业务操作都能基于最新的余额数据进行,避免了数据不一致可能导致的业务风险。

(二)缺点

1、单点故障风险

- 集中式信息处理系统的最大风险之一是单点故障,由于所有的数据和处理都依赖于一个中心节点,如果这个中心节点出现故障,例如服务器硬件损坏、软件崩溃或者遭受网络攻击,整个系统可能会瘫痪,对于一些对业务连续性要求极高的企业,如金融机构或大型电商平台,这种故障可能会导致巨大的经济损失和客户信任危机,即使有备份和恢复机制,从故障中恢复的时间也可能较长,期间业务无法正常开展。

- 在自然灾害或其他不可抗力事件发生时,位于特定地理位置的集中式数据中心可能会受到严重影响,如果数据中心位于地震多发区,一旦发生地震,可能会破坏数据中心的基础设施,导致数据丢失和业务中断。

集中式和分布式信息处理的优缺点有哪些,集中式和分布式信息处理的优缺点

图片来源于网络,如有侵权联系删除

2、可扩展性有限

- 随着企业业务的发展和用户数量的增加,集中式系统的可扩展性面临挑战,当需要扩展系统容量时,可能需要对中心服务器进行硬件升级,如增加内存、磁盘空间或处理器性能,这种升级往往受到硬件设备的限制,而且升级过程可能会影响系统的正常运行,在一个集中式的企业资源规划(ERP)系统中,当企业的业务规模扩大,需要处理更多的订单、库存和财务数据时,现有的中心服务器可能无法满足性能要求,而对服务器进行大规模升级可能需要较长的停机时间,这对于企业的日常运营是不利的。

- 集中式系统在软件架构上也可能存在可扩展性问题,如果系统最初设计时没有考虑到大规模扩展的需求,随着功能和用户数量的增加,软件的复杂度会急剧上升,导致开发和维护成本增加,系统性能下降。

3、响应速度可能受影响

- 由于所有的请求都要发送到中心节点进行处理,在网络拥塞或者中心节点负载过高的情况下,响应速度可能会受到影响,对于分布在不同地理位置的用户来说,远距离的网络传输会增加延迟,一家跨国公司在全球各地有分支机构,如果采用集中式的办公自动化系统,位于偏远地区的员工在访问系统时可能会遇到较长的响应时间,影响工作效率。

二、分布式信息处理的优缺点

(一)优点

1、高可靠性与容错性

- 分布式信息处理系统将数据和任务分散在多个节点上,当其中一个节点出现故障时,其他节点可以继续工作,系统仍然能够正常运行,在分布式的文件存储系统中,如Ceph,数据被分割成多个块并存储在不同的节点上,如果一个节点的磁盘损坏,系统可以通过其他节点上存储的数据块进行恢复,不会导致数据丢失,保证了系统的可靠性。

- 这种容错能力使得分布式系统在面对硬件故障、软件错误或网络问题时具有更强的适应性,在大规模的云计算环境中,分布式架构可以确保即使部分服务器出现故障,云服务仍然可以为用户提供稳定的计算、存储和网络服务。

2、良好的可扩展性

- 分布式系统可以方便地通过添加新的节点来扩展系统的容量和性能,无论是增加计算能力、存储容量还是网络带宽,都可以通过简单地添加新的硬件设备或节点来实现,在一个分布式的大数据处理平台,如Hadoop,当需要处理更多的数据时,可以向集群中添加新的计算节点,这些新节点可以立即参与到数据处理任务中,提高整个系统的处理能力。

- 分布式系统的软件架构也更容易适应业务的扩展,新的功能和服务可以分布在不同的节点上开发和部署,不会对整个系统造成过大的冲击,这使得企业在业务发展过程中能够灵活地调整系统架构,满足不断增长的需求。

集中式和分布式信息处理的优缺点有哪些,集中式和分布式信息处理的优缺点

图片来源于网络,如有侵权联系删除

3、响应速度快

- 分布式系统可以根据用户的地理位置将数据和服务分布在离用户较近的节点上,这样可以减少网络传输的距离和延迟,提高响应速度,内容分发网络(CDN)就是一种分布式系统,它将网站的内容缓存到全球各地的服务器节点上,当用户请求访问网站时,可以从距离自己最近的节点获取内容,大大提高了网页的加载速度,改善了用户体验。

(二)缺点

1、管理复杂性

- 分布式信息处理系统的管理相对复杂,由于数据和任务分布在多个节点上,需要对每个节点进行单独的配置、监控和维护,不同节点可能运行不同的操作系统、软件版本,这增加了系统管理的难度,在一个分布式的物联网系统中,有大量的传感器节点分布在不同的环境中,每个节点都需要进行设备管理、软件更新和故障排查,这对管理员的技术能力和管理工作量都提出了很高的要求。

- 分布式系统中的数据一致性维护也更加复杂,在多个节点同时对数据进行更新时,需要采用复杂的一致性协议,如Paxos或Raft,以确保所有节点上的数据最终保持一致,这些协议的实现和维护需要较高的技术水平和资源投入。

2、安全挑战

- 分布式系统的安全管理面临诸多挑战,由于节点众多且分布广泛,容易受到攻击的面更广,攻击者可能会针对单个节点进行攻击,从而获取系统的部分数据或控制权,在分布式的区块链系统中,虽然区块链本身具有一定的安全性机制,但节点可能会遭受黑客攻击,如分布式拒绝服务(DDoS)攻击,影响整个系统的正常运行。

- 数据在分布式系统中的传输和存储也需要更高的安全保障,因为数据分布在多个节点上,数据的加密、访问控制和隐私保护等都需要更加精细的设计和管理,以防止数据泄露和滥用。

3、资源协调与成本

- 分布式系统需要对多个节点的资源进行协调,在资源分配不均匀的情况下,可能会导致部分节点资源闲置,而部分节点资源紧张的情况,在一个分布式的计算集群中,如果任务调度不合理,可能会出现一些节点计算能力过剩,而另一些节点计算能力不足的现象,影响整个系统的效率。

- 构建和运行分布式系统的成本相对较高,需要购买更多的硬件设备、网络设备以及相关的软件许可证,由于系统的复杂性,需要投入更多的人力进行开发、维护和管理,这增加了企业的总体成本。

标签: #集中式 #分布式 #信息处理 #优缺点

黑狐家游戏
  • 评论列表

留言评论